Allen Wayne York was born on September 7, 1943, to the late Robert York and Elizabeth Cooper York in Sardis, Arkansas. He passed from this life to his home in Heaven on June 22, 2018, following a brief illness.
Wayne is survived by wife Dian Jennings York, son Darby York (Amiee), daughter Shae McCormick (Ryan) and son Cody York (Erica), grandchildren, Avery, Chase, Ella, Tyler and Mitchell, sisters, Bobbie Barrett, Kathleen Bevill, Roberta Leonard, Beth Doberstein (Gary) and sister-in-law, Celeste York and a host of nieces and nephews.
He is preceded in death by his brothers and their spouses: Mirrill York (Irene), Thirl York (Orpha), Elmo York (Velma), Jack York (Margaret), Leo York, Charles York (Sue), brothers-in-law, Carl Bevill, Al Leonard and Jim Barrett, sisters and their spouses, Wilma Fuqua (Hugh), Dorothy Bridgman (Frank) and Faye Murry (DA).
Wayne attended High School in North Little Rock, college at the University of Central Arkansas, and graduated from the University of Arkansas at Fayetteville. He retired from the Arkansas School for the Deaf after teaching for 30 years.
Wayne was an artist and avid sports fan, music lover, gifted writer and a fierce competitor. He had a great sense of humor, was a generous giver and always rooted for the underdog.
